Well, In some ways he is, but I find think CAS and HPL complement eachother well. Clarke tends to vividly describe his demons, ghouls and monsters with his poet's vocabulary, while Lovecraft interestingly avoids outright descriptions, or skirts around the malevolence by hints, rumors and suggestions, and this allows for some more compelling plots. It's a source of wonder for me they were writing for the same lowly pulp rag in the thirties. As for Robert Howard, he's at least a step below them.

Ol' Clark will be there when you're ready. Like any short story collections they're best read between other things. There's no real reading order, but The Tale Of Satampra Zeiros and The Abominations of Yondo feel like good introductions. Harlan Ellison was nuts about The City Of The Singing Flame and that's a great SF story.
